Barbara worked for NY Telephone, McCory’s Dept Store ; Voyager Emblem and retired from Verizon Communications.
Barbara loved to dance. She and her husband, Guyon belonged to several dancing groups, they enjoyed square dancing, round dancing and line dancing. They also enjoyed traveling together. Sadly, he predeceased her in 2008. She was a former member of St. Vincent de Paul Parish and St. Peter’s RC Church.
She is the beloved mother of Darlene (David) Ivey and Danny Draper; dearest grandmother of Christopher (Kara Stock) Ivey and Jennifer (Anthony) DeVantier; great grandmother of Emily DeVantier; dearest sister of Robert S. (Nancy) Veihdeffer; Richard L. (Mischelle) Veihdeffer; several nieces and nephews. She was predeceased by her parents, her husband and siblings, Beverly J. Deal; Joan Rowland and Edwin V. Veihdeffer.
Private services will be held for the family. The family wishes to extend their greatest appreciation to the staff of Elderwood Independent Living Facility.
